Moving Within the Framework of My Values

 


This is another eye opening week for me.
I have learned from a case study where willingness to listen is crucial for business.
Listening can open many opportunities to meet the needs of people. 

This week I also learned more about my own values and passion. I have drawn this illustration for anyone's reflection. 

At the end, we are not measured by money. 
We are measured by our contribution, characters as a good person, and relationship with others.

My Most Meaningful Habit: Begin with the End in Mind

  Out of the seven habits of highly effective people, my most meaningful habit it “Begin with the End in Mind”. The book reads “ There’s a mental or first creation, and a physical or second creation. The first creation can be either by conscious design, or as a result of outside pressures. In real life, w hen the artist draws something, he already has a clear picture of what he is drawing. It is not possible that he draws when he is thinking about what to draw. If I have a clear vision of my destination, my efforts would be more effective and productive in my daily activities. When we begin with the end in mind, our lives cam be more meaningful and stay on the righteous personal constitution. The book explains that a personal constitution is a written standard, the key criterion by which everything is evaluated and direct. Personal constitution shows the end state in mind.
